Uniform

Once students are settled, we expect them to wear the appropriate uniform (as detailed below).

Coming to class feeling neat and clean is important for students' confidence, and provides a sense of occasion beneficial to learning.


We are especially keen that students with long hair wear it out of their face, preferably in a bun (a tutorial can be found below).


From Grade 1 upwards students will require, alongside their ballet uniform, a specific character uniform.


To stay warm as we head into winter we request that students either place an order with Mrs Brewer for a BDA T-shirt, 

and/or wear a cross-over cardigan in their uniform colour.


Please note- we know younger students are always growing and provide a secondhand shoe store on certain days during term. All proceeds go to charity.

    Character (grades 1 - 8)

    SHOES

    Canvas Character shoes in BLACK with elastic across instep.

    Available in two heel types, the low heel is recommended for Grades 1 & 2, and the Cuban heel for Grades 3 - 8


    SKIRTS

    BLACK Full circular skirt, approximately mid calf length, in cotton. Our preferred ribbon colours can be found here and here, but students are free to express some individuality. 

    Instructions for making your own skirt are available on request.

    Vocational Grades and Contemporary

    INTERMEDIATE / ADVANCED FOUNDATION


    Royal Academy of Dance uniform for vocational level exams is a simple sleeveless or capped sleeve leotard, with an optional matching short skirt. 


    For exams, BDA recommends students wear BLACK, and opt for leotard styles explicitly approved by the RAD website.


    However, as vocational level classes are for older students we trust them to tastefully express individuality. When not preparing for an exam students may wear dancewear in class of ANY STYLE, ANY COLOUR, or indeed many colours!


    (Shoes and tights, including pointe shoes, should be pink or match skin tone.)


    This is also the case for our workshops and non RAD classes.

    Pointework

    Students of a certain age will be invited to start Pre-Pointe classes, 

    for these they may need:


    A spiky massage ball or tennis ball.

     A balance board and/or wobble board.

    A toe band.

    Therabands (ideally both easy and medium/hard strength).

     A tea towel.

    A yoga/dance mat 

    A Pilates ball or small cushion.

    A notepad and pen.


     Students should be barefoot. and wear a leotard with an optional ballet wrap skirt or tight exercise shorts. Hair should be tied into a bun (or other secure hairstyle). Students will NOT need to buy pointe shoes until explicitly indicated by their teacher, who will give clear advice about getting and caring for their first pair.
